About MRU Camps

Extraordinary kids deserve extraordinary camps! At MRU Camps we strive to offer high-quality programming for children and youth in a fun, innovative, and culturally inclusive environment since 1990. MRU Camps focuses on providing an environment where children and youth can grow and thrive to the best of their potential.

About the Role

MRU Camps is looking for enthusiastic individuals who are interested in sharing their knowledge, passion, and expertise with children and youth in ST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ics). Under the supervision of the STEM Education (SE) Supervisor, the Instructor is responsible for delivering lessons and leading campers through a variety of activities such as crafts, sports, and games. Additional responsibilities include the completion of required administrative duties and maintaining smooth, cooperative, and professional relations with staff, campers, and parents. Camp Instructors will also work closely with Camp Leaders and Volunteers.

These are casual positions ending August 29, 2025. The hours of work are between 7:00am – 6:00pm, Monday to Friday. Camp Instructors must be available for all 9 weeks of employment (June 30 - August 29, 2025) and orientation week (June 23-27, 2025).

All MRU Camps staff are required to provide the following at their own cost prior to commencement:

  • Police Information Check and Vulnerable Sector Search (valid within 1 year).
  • Standard First Aid (valid within 2 years) and CPR Level C (valid within 1 year).
Responsibilities
  • Plan, deliver and modify program lessons and activities.
  • Ensure safety, well-being and enjoyment of campers from ages 4 - 15 years old.
  • Make accommodations for campers with varying learning needs.
  • Work collaboratively with co-Leaders and Instructors to deliver daily programs.
  • Assist Camp Leaders with recreational and classroom activities.
  • Supervise and coordinate lunchtime, before and after care.
  • Administrative tasks associated with the program including camper registration, incident reports, and attendance.
  • Attend staff orientation and any necessary staff meetings.
  • Communicate professionally with parents and guardians about their child’s experience at camp.
Qualifications
  • Experience working in a childcare/educational setting delivering lesson plans and curriculum (minimum 1 year).
  • Previous experience working or volunteering in camp related or recreational activities is an asset.
  • Previous experience with curriculum design and implementation is an asset.
  • The ability to work well in a team and individually.
  • Strong organizational skills and attention to detail.
  • Excellent communication and conflict resolution skills.
  • Previous experience in or a passion for S.T.E.M. (science, technology, engineering, and mathematics) and/or coaching/teaching.
  • Must be available for 40 hours per week (8 hours per day), Monday to Friday, June 30 - August 29, 2025.
  • Must be available for mandatory staff training June 23-27, 2025.
